Як встановити хмара тегів
Вам знадобиться
- Установка плагіна Wp-cumulus.
Інструкція
Хмара тегів являє собою набір ярликів або категорій, що найчастіше зустрічаються в пошуку, засланнях і згадок будь-яких слів. І чим частіше зустрічається те чи інше слово або поняття, тим більше стає зображення, що містить гіперпосилання на ці поняття і слова.
1. lt ;?
2. class TagsCloud {
3.
4. private $ tags;
5.
6. private $ font_size_min = 14;
7. private $ font_size_step = 5;
8.
9. function __construct ($ tags) {
10.
11. shuffle ($ tags);
12. $ this-gt; tags = $ tags;
13.
14.}
15.
16. private function get_tag_count ($ tag_name, $ tags) {
17.
18. $ count = 0;
19.
20. foreach ($ tags as $ tag) {
21. if ($ tag == $ tag_name) {
22. $ count ++;
23.}
24.}
25.
26. return $ count;
27.
28.}
29.
30. private function tagscloud ($ tags) {
31.
32. $ tags_list = array ();
33.
34. foreach ($ tags as $ tag) {
35. $ tags_list [$ tag] = self :: get_tag_count ($ tag, $ tags);
36.}
37.
38. return $ tags_list;
39.
40.}
41.
42. private function get_min_count ($ tags_list) {
43.
44. $ min = $ tags_list [$ this-gt; tags [0]];
45.
46. foreach ($ tags_list as $ tag_count) {
47.
48. if ($ tag_count lt; $ Min) $ min = $ tag_count;
49.
50.}
51.
52. return $ min;
53.
54.}
55.
56. public function get_cloud () {
57.
58. $ cloud = Array ();
59.
60. $ tags_list = self :: tagscloud ($ this-gt; tags);
61. $ min_count = self :: get_min_count ($ tags_list);
62.
63. foreach ($ tags_list as $ tag = gt; $ count) {
64.
65. $ font_steps = $ count - $ min_count;
66. $ font_size = $ this-gt; font_size_min + $ this-gt; font_size_step * $ font_steps;
67.
68. $ cloud [] = "". $ Tag. "";
69.}
70.
71. return $ cloud;
72.
73.}
74.}
75.? Gt;
01. lt ;?
02.
03. $ tags = array (
04. `1111`,` 2222`, `333`,` 444`,
05. `5555`,` 666`, `777`,` 777`,
06. `333`,` 8888`, `6666`,` 333`,
07. `888`,` 000rsquo-, `989`,` 45455`,
08. `5555`,` 63636`, `54545`,` 55656`
09.);
10.
11. $ mycloud = new TagsCloud ($ tags);
12. $ tags_list = $ mycloud-gt; get_cloud ();
13.
14. foreach ($ tags_list as $ tag) {
15. echo $ tag.` `;
16.}
17.
18.? Gt;
На місці цифр ставте потрібні вам теги!
Відео: Як встановити хмара тегів на сайт WordPress
Відео: Хмара тегів
Удачі вам у створенні власних хмар!
- Як встановити розширення joomla
- Як встановити плагін на сервер
- Як встановити плагіни вручну
- Як включити на сервері плагіни
- Як поставити плагіни на сервер
- Як поставити плагін в одиночну гру в minecraft
- Як вставляти плагіни
- Як написати плагін wordpress
- Як поставити хмара тегів
- Як зробити хмара тегів
- Як залити фільм на свій сайт
- Як виводити букви
- Як зробити хмара тегів
- Як на посилання поставити картинку
- Як прибрати спам з сайту
- Як ставити плагіни oblivion
- Як зробити форму коментарів
- Як встановлювати плагіни для кс 1.6
- Як зробити посторінкову навігацію
- Як зайти в редагування сайту
- Як включити плагіни в кс